Presidential candidate Vivek Ramaswamy announced Tuesday that any prospective members of his hypothetical presidential administration must sign a pledge rejecting neoconservative foreign policy beliefs.
“STOP WORLD WAR III,” he posted on X, the platform formerly known as Twitter.

The link leads to a “No to Neocons” pledge, which it says prospective political appointees must sign and commit to if they want to be considered for roles in a Ramaswamy administration.
The pledge includes three statements. According to Ramaswamy, potential administration members must agree “Avoiding WW3 is a vital national objective,” “War is never a preference, only a necessity,” and “The sole duty of U.S. policymakers is to U.S. citizens.”
As Ukraine fends off an invasion from Russia and Israel is warring with Iran-backed terrorist group Hamas, Ramaswamy has been vocal in his opposition to additional emergency aid to the countries. He has suggested the U.S. needs to focus on issues domestically instead.
